
在Excel中,自动求和功能可以通过多种方式实现,包括使用快捷键、公式和工具栏按钮等。快捷键Alt + =、SUM函数、自动求和按钮是常用的方法。 在实际操作中,快捷键Alt + = 是最快速的方法,只需选中需要求和的单元格区域,然后按下快捷键即可自动生成求和公式。下面将详细介绍这些方法,并提供一些实用技巧和注意事项。
一、快捷键Alt + =实现自动求和
快捷键Alt + = 是在Excel中快速求和的一个非常高效的工具。通过这个快捷键,用户可以迅速生成求和公式。
快捷键使用步骤
- 选中目标区域:首先,选择你想要求和的单元格区域。
- 按快捷键:然后,按下Alt键并保持不放,再按等号键 (=)。
- 确认公式:Excel会自动在选中的单元格下方或右侧生成一个求和公式。按Enter键确认即可。
注意事项
- 区域选择:确保选中的区域是连续的单元格,否则Excel无法正确生成求和公式。
- 空白单元格:如果区域中有空白单元格,Excel会忽略它们,不影响最终结果。
二、使用SUM函数进行自动求和
SUM函数是Excel中最常用的求和函数。它不仅可以对连续区域求和,还可以对不连续的单元格求和。
SUM函数的基本用法
- 选择单元格:选择你希望显示求和结果的单元格。
- 输入公式:在选中的单元格中输入
=SUM(。 - 选择范围:选中你希望求和的单元格范围,或者手动输入范围,例如
A1:A10。 - 完成公式:输入右括号
),完成公式,按Enter键确认。
高级用法
- 多区域求和:可以对多个不连续的区域求和,例如
=SUM(A1:A10, C1:C10)。 - 条件求和:结合IF函数可以实现条件求和,例如
=SUM(IF(A1:A10>5, A1:A10, 0))。
三、使用工具栏按钮进行自动求和
Excel的工具栏中提供了自动求和按钮,使用这个按钮可以快速实现求和操作。
工具栏按钮使用步骤
- 选择单元格:选择你希望显示求和结果的单元格。
- 点击自动求和按钮:在Excel的“开始”选项卡中,找到“自动求和”按钮并点击。
- 确认公式:Excel会自动识别需要求和的区域,并生成SUM公式。按Enter键确认。
实用技巧
- 快捷工具栏:将自动求和按钮添加到快捷工具栏,可以更方便地使用。
- 自定义范围:如果Excel自动识别的区域不正确,可以手动调整范围,然后确认公式。
四、通过表格工具实现自动求和
Excel中的表格工具可以帮助用户更高效地进行数据管理和计算。将数据转换为表格后,Excel会自动生成求和行。
将数据转换为表格
- 选择数据区域:选中你希望转换为表格的数据区域。
- 插入表格:在“插入”选项卡中,点击“表格”按钮。确认弹出的对话框中选择的区域。
- 自动求和行:在表格工具“设计”选项卡中,勾选“总计行”选项。Excel会自动在表格底部生成求和行。
使用表格工具的优点
- 自动更新:表格中的数据更新后,求和结果会自动更新。
- 灵活性:可以快速添加新的数据和计算项目,表格会自动调整。
五、使用数组公式进行高级求和
数组公式是Excel中一个强大的工具,适用于复杂的求和计算需求。
基本数组公式用法
- 选择目标单元格:选择你希望显示求和结果的单元格。
- 输入数组公式:在选中的单元格中输入数组公式,例如
=SUM(A1:A10*B1:B10)。 - 确认公式:按Ctrl + Shift + Enter键确认公式,Excel会自动生成大括号
{}包围的数组公式。
高级数组公式
- 条件求和:可以结合数组公式实现复杂的条件求和,例如
=SUM((A1:A10>5)*(B1:B10))。 - 多条件求和:结合多个条件进行求和,例如
=SUM((A1:A10>5)*(B1:B10<10)*(C1:C10))。
六、使用Power Query进行数据求和
Power Query是Excel中的一个强大工具,适用于复杂的数据处理和计算需求。
使用Power Query步骤
- 加载数据:在“数据”选项卡中,点击“获取数据”按钮,将数据加载到Power Query编辑器中。
- 数据转换:在Power Query编辑器中,进行必要的数据转换和清洗操作。
- 添加求和列:使用Power Query的“添加列”功能,添加一个求和列。
- 加载结果:将处理后的数据加载回Excel工作表中。
Power Query的优势
- 自动化处理:可以自动执行复杂的数据处理和计算任务。
- 动态更新:数据源更新后,求和结果会自动更新。
七、使用VBA宏实现自动求和
VBA宏是Excel中的一个高级工具,适用于需要自动化任务和复杂计算的用户。
基本VBA宏求和
- 打开VBA编辑器:按Alt + F11打开VBA编辑器。
- 插入模块:在VBA编辑器中,插入一个新模块。
- 编写宏代码:编写求和宏代码,例如:
Sub AutoSum()
Range("B1").Value = WorksheetFunction.Sum(Range("A1:A10"))
End Sub
- 运行宏:关闭VBA编辑器,返回Excel工作表,按Alt + F8运行宏。
高级VBA宏
- 动态区域求和:编写宏代码,自动识别并求和动态数据区域。
- 批量处理:使用VBA宏批量处理多个工作表的求和任务。
八、求和过程中常见问题及解决方法
在使用Excel进行自动求和的过程中,可能会遇到一些常见问题。下面列出几个常见问题及其解决方法。
常见问题一:求和结果错误
- 原因:可能是数据区域选择错误或包含非数值单元格。
- 解决方法:检查并确保选中的数据区域正确,且不包含非数值单元格。
常见问题二:SUM函数不工作
- 原因:可能是公式输入错误或数据格式不正确。
- 解决方法:检查公式输入是否正确,确保数据格式为数值格式。
常见问题三:求和结果不自动更新
- 原因:可能是手动计算模式导致。
- 解决方法:在“公式”选项卡中,确保计算模式设置为“自动计算”。
九、优化Excel求和性能的技巧
在处理大数据集时,Excel求和操作可能会影响性能。以下是一些优化技巧。
技巧一:使用表格
将数据转换为表格,可以提高数据管理和计算效率。
技巧二:减少复杂公式
尽量减少使用复杂的数组公式和嵌套函数,简化计算过程。
技巧三:使用辅助列
通过添加辅助列,将复杂计算分解为简单步骤,提高计算效率。
技巧四:定期清理数据
定期清理和优化数据,删除不必要的空白单元格和格式。
通过以上方法和技巧,可以在Excel中高效、准确地实现自动求和。无论是快捷键、SUM函数、工具栏按钮,还是高级的数组公式和VBA宏,都可以根据具体需求选择合适的方法。希望这些内容对您在使用Excel进行数据处理和计算时有所帮助。
相关问答FAQs:
1. 如何在Excel中使用自动求和功能?
在Excel中,您可以使用自动求和功能轻松地对选定的数据进行求和。只需选择要求和的数据范围,然后点击Excel工具栏中的“求和”按钮。Excel会自动计算选定范围内的所有数值的总和,并将结果显示在所选单元格中。
2. 如何在Excel中对特定列进行自动求和?
如果您只想对某一列的数据进行求和,可以使用Excel的自动求和功能。首先,选择要求和的列,然后在Excel工具栏中点击“求和”按钮。Excel会自动计算所选列中的所有数值的总和,并将结果显示在所选列的最后一个单元格中。
3. 如何在Excel中使用自动求和功能对多个不相邻的数据进行求和?
如果您想对多个不相邻的数据进行求和,可以使用Excel的自动求和功能。首先,选择第一个数据范围,然后按住Ctrl键选择其他要求和的数据范围。最后,在Excel工具栏中点击“求和”按钮。Excel会自动计算选定范围内的所有数值的总和,并将结果显示在所选单元格中。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4693354